37.6 Alternative Routing on Detection of Failed SIP
Response
The device can detect failure of a sent SIP response (e.g., TCP timeout, and UDP ICMP).
In such a scenario, the device re-sends the response to an alternative destination. This
support is in addition to alternative routing if the device detects failed SIP requests.
For example, assume the device sends a SIP 200 OK in response to a received INVITE
request. If the device does not receive a SIP ACK in response to this, it sends a new 200
OK to the next alternative destination. This new destination can be the next given IP
address resolved from a DNS from the Contact or Record-Route header in the request
related to the response.
